Saturday, October 8, 8:30am-5pm - 16th Annual At-Home Dads Convention, Teacher Training Facility, George Washington Middle School, Alexandria, VA
Keynote Speaker: Dr. Aaron Rochlen, Associate Professor in Counseling Psychology at the University of Texas at Austin, will discuss the practical implications of his recently published study of women married to at-home dads.
Other educational sessions will include: Dad-to-Dad Age-Group Open Forum Discussions, At-Home Work Outs for At-Home Dads, How to Start a Safe Routes to School Program, Making Dad Blogs Great, Being a Good Sports Parent, Growing Your At-Home Dad Group, and much MUCH MORE!!!
